These tabletop machines are four-axis
robots offering a high payload and
excellent repeatability, all in a very
compact and industrialized package. The innovative Tri-Link arm provides
for
a superior extended reach as well as
the ability to fully retract in on itself.
The simplistic design and software has
proven to be exceptionally reliable. No separate controller is required
other
than a standard PC. All joints are
driven by servos with controllers and
amplifiers integral to each motor. A
single RS-232 serial cable connects
between the robot and the PC. |

Designed for demanding applications,
these robots are perfect for many
laboratory and high-tech applications
such as drug discovery, genetic
analysis, high throughput screening and
semiconductor handling.
